Warning Signs You Need Water Heater Leak Water Removal

Ignoring warning signs can lead to costly repairs and even health risks. Don’t wait until it’s too late. Be aware of these common warning signs that show you need Water Heater Leak Water Removal services:

Musty Odors That Won’t Go Away

Strong, persistent odors can be a sign of mold growth or water damage. If you notice musty smells in your home, it’s essential to address the issue quickly.

Water Stains on Your Ceiling or Walls

Water stains can be a sign of a leak or water damage. If you notice stains on your ceiling or walls, it’s crucial to investigate the source and address the issue quickly.

Buckled or Warped Flooring

Buckled or warped flooring can be a sign of water damage or a leak. If you notice any changes in your flooring, it’s essential to investigate the issue quickly.

Increased Water Bills

Unexplained increases in your water bills can be a sign of a leak or water damage. If you notice any unusual changes in your water bills, it’s crucial to investigate the issue quickly.

Visible Water Leaks

Visible water leaks can be a sign of a serious issue. If you notice any water leaks, it’s essential to address the issue quickly to prevent further damage.

Warped or Rotting Wood

Warped or rotting wood can be a sign of water damage or a leak. If you notice any changes in your wood surfaces, it’s crucial to investigate the issue quickly.

Water Heater Leak Water Removal Cost in Farmersville, CA

The cost of Water Heater Leak Water Removal services can vary depending on the severity of the damage, the size of the affected area, and local conditions in Farmersville, CA. Our team provides free estimates to help you understand the cost of our services. Here’s a breakdown of typical price ranges for our Water Heater Leak Water Removal services:

Service Typical Price Range What Affects Cost
Water Extraction $500 – $2,500 The cost of water extraction services depends on the amount of water involved and the equipment needed to remove it.
Drying and Dehumidification $1,000 – $5,000 The cost of drying and dehumidification services depends on the size of the affected area and the equipment needed to dry it.
Sanitizing and Disinfecting $500 – $2,000 The cost of sanitizing and disinfecting services depends on the size of the affected area and the equipment needed to sanitize it.
Restoration and Reconstruction $2,000 – $10,000 The cost of restoration and reconstruction services depends on the extent of the damage and the materials needed to restore your property.
